BMW Sneyers Herentals in Belgium is bringing to life their own interpretation of the BMW M2 Competition with M Performance Parts. Using the base car as a Sunset Orange M2C, the Belgium dealership dives deep into the M Performance catalog to fit the car with some aero parts. Starting at the from, the BMW M2 Competition stands out with a bonnet made of carbon fiber with partially visible varnished carbon fiber. This is not only a real eyecatcher; this is also the first time the BMW M2 Competition boasts a powerdome. This engine hood reduces the load on the front axle by approximately nine kilograms, too.

The M Performance front side panel in carbon fiber at the front, left/right with integrated air outlets made of visible carbon fiber reduces weight even more. For increased contact pressure and therefore more stability at higher speeds, the M2 Competition features several aerodynamic attachments. Front splits, aero-winglets on the front and on the side skirts reduce lift, enhancing the driving dynamics, especially in fast corners.

On the side, the M Performance Parts come in form of exterior mirror caps in carbon fiber, door sill finisher in carbon fiber and side skirt extensions in carbon fiber.

Moving to the rear, we can see a rear diffusor in carbon fiber and a rear spoiler in carbon fiber. Racing sound on the road is provided by the M Performance exhaust system. The lightweight construction flap exhaust system made of stainless steel features a titanium rear silencer and 93 millimeter tailpipes made of carbon fiber with M logo. The sound ranges from sporty (Efficient Mode) to uncompromising racing acoustics (Sport Mode and Sport+ Mode) thereby emphasizing the unique 6-cylinder bi-turbo sound even further. Of course this exhaust system (available from 9/2018) saves weight as well – approximately 32 percent (8 kg) as compared to the series production part.
